Career Day in Aging!
March 14, 10:00am - 2:00pmMānoa Campus, Campus Center Ballroom

The Hawaii Pacific Gerontological Society and University of Hawaii Center on Aging are co-sponsoring a career day and job fair on Tuesday, March 14th, at the University of Hawaii at Manoa, Campus Center Ballroom, on the 2nd floor from 10am to 2pm. The purpose of this Career Day/Job Fair is to educate individuals about the range of career opportunities available in the field of aging and health care.
Vendors will represent diverse sectors of the aging field- from health care, architecture, business and more. There will be FREE PIZZA and refreshments, and DOOR PRIZES. Also- counselors from the MANOA CAREER CENTER will be on hand. Bring your questions and consult with them about career planning, job searches, and resume writing!
Vendors include:
Aloha Nursing Rehab Centre, Alzheimer’s Association Aloha Chapter, Architects Hawaii Limited, Bayada Home Care, Bristol Hospice, Generations Magazine w/ Project Dana, Hale Hauoli Adult Day Care, Hale Ho Aloha, Inc., Hale Kuike, LLC, Hawaii Center for Psychology, Hawaii SHIP, HMSA, Kahala Nui, Kokua Care, Lanakila Pacific, Manoa Cottage Kaimuki/Manoa Cottage Care Homes, Palolo Chinese Home, Rulon & Adamshick LLC, Senior Move Managers/De-Clutter Hawaii, Talent HR Solutions, The Caregiver Foundation, The Ihara Team of Keller Williams Honolulu, The Plaza Assisted Living... and more will be added.
This event is free and open to all college students and high school students on Oahu, as well as anyone looking for a career or change in career.
